問題タブ [n-dimensional]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
2 に答える
63 参照

matlab - Matlabは列データをndarrayに変換します

Matlab の一連のカテゴリに従って値のベクトルをグループ化する簡単な (理想的には複数の for ループなしで) 方法はありますか?

私はフォームにデータマトリックスを持っています

私が欲しいのはN次元配列です

もちろん、同じカテゴリの組み合わせを持つ値はいくつでもある可能性があるためsize(end)、最大のカテゴリの値の数になります。残りの項目は で埋められnanます。

あるいは、私は満足しています

つまり、ベクトルのセル配列です。ピボット テーブルの作成に少し似ていると思いますが、n 次元を使用し、mean.

ヘルプでこの機能を見つけました

しかし、私はそれを自分のやりたいようにする方法を理解できませんでした!

0 投票する
1 に答える
1226 参照

c++ - この乗算表を if 文で出力するにはどうすればよいですか?

このコードのポイントは、1 次元配列を使用して乗算表を作成することです。すべてが正しくコーディングされていると思いますが、この割り当ての他の部分は、if ステートメントを使用してテーブルを出力することであり、その方法は完全にはわかりません。誰かが私にいくつかのガイダンスを教えてもらえますか?

0 投票する
2 に答える
336 参照

arrays - Scala の 6 次元以上の配列

私は Scala で多次元配列を調べていて、多次元配列を作成する簡単な方法を見つけました。すなわち:

val my3DimensionalArray = Array.ofDim[Int](3,4,5) //array with dimensions 3 x 4 x 5

あるいは

val myFilledArray = Array.fill[Int](3,4,5)(0) //Array of same dimension filled with 0's

ただし、これは 1 ~ 5 次元の配列でのみ機能します。

val my6DimensionalArray = Array.ofDim[Int](3,3,3,3,3,3) //Error

では、より高次元の配列を作成する場合、人々は通常どのように対処するのでしょうか? これはサードパーティのライブラリの実装に任されているのでしょうか、それとも高次元配列の代わりに使用することを Scala が奨励している他のデータ構造はありますか?

0 投票する
2 に答える
2233 参照

javascript - Jquery inArray メソッドが多次元配列で機能しない

Jquery の inArray 関数を使用して、配列内の重複するサブ配列の作成を停止する関数を作成しようとしていますが、機能していないようです。多分私は私のコードに何かが欠けていますか?

残りのコードブロックを追加して読みやすくしましたが、inArray関数を呼び出すifブロックに焦点を当てています。なぜなら、重複した製品がまだ追加されているからです

0 投票する
1 に答える
484 参照

matlab - ビー玉の任意の袋のシミュレーション

そのため、ビー玉の袋の任意のモデルをシミュレートしようとしています (これがどのように機能するかが異なる場合は、置き換えて)、結果を表示する際に問題が発生しています。

私がどのようにセットアップしたかというと、コードは、袋に入っているビー玉の数、選択したいビー玉の数、そして異なる色がいくつあるかを尋ねます。(それぞれ N、S、および k として定義されます)。次に、セル配列で 1 と k の間のループを実行して、ビー玉の色に名前を付けます。次に、バッグに各色がいくつあるかを尋ねることで確率をシミュレートする 2 つ目の配列を作成します。次に、10 の「ゲーム」をシミュレートするランダム マトリックスを生成します (つまり、rDist=randi(N,[10,S]); ビー玉を選択したので、別の 10xS セル配列を作成し、選択した数に基づいてビー玉の色でそのセル配列を塗りつぶします。つまり、10 個のビー玉があり、7 個が赤で 3 個が緑であるとします。PRNG が 1:7 を選択した場合、結果のセル配列に「赤」と表示され、8:10 が選択された場合、対応する位置に「緑」が表示されます。私はこれを有限数で行うことができますが、大理石の色の任意の数の分布でこれを K の大理石の色に拡張したいと考えています。何かお手伝いできますか?

2 つの大理石タイプに対する私の「有限」ソリューションは以下のとおりです。

0 投票する
1 に答える
311 参照

java - N 次元ポイント クラス

Java 結果: 1

この問題はどのように解決されますか?

データベースから取得したポイントにデータがどのように割り当てられますか?

0 投票する
1 に答える
2365 参照

math - フラクタルの次元: ボクシング カウント、ハウスドルフ、R^n 空間でのパッキング

0 と 1 の n 次元配列として書かれたフラクタルの次元を計算したいと思います。これには、箱詰め数、ハウスドルフ、梱包寸法が含まれます。

ボクシング カウント次元をコーディングする方法しか考えていません (n 次元マトリックスで 1 を数えてから、次の式を使用するだけです。

wheren-number of 1'sn-space dimension (R^n) このアプローチは、最小解像度ボックスのカウントをシミュレートする1 x 1 x ... x 1ため、数値は のようになりlimit eps->0ます。このソリューションについてどう思いますか?

ハウスドルフまたはパッキング寸法を計算するためのアイデア (またはコード) はありますか?

0 投票する
2 に答える
381 参照

haskell - haskellでn次元ベクトルの回転と反射を定義する方法は?

関数がHaskellのn次元で機能する場合、一般的にベクトルの回転と反射を定義するにはどうすればよいですか?

現在、内積、正規化、投影を行っていますが、反射と回転に固執しています。

私は何日も検索してきましたが、Haskell を使用して数学を理解すると、明確なコードがなく (またはコードがまったくない)、n 次元ベクトルに関するチュートリアルだけが私の数学の知識を超えている場合に問題が発生することがあるようです。

0 投票する
2 に答える
637 参照

solr - 多次元空間で Solr を使用して n 個の最も近い点を見つける

Solr の専門家の皆様、私の問題についてアドバイスをいただければ幸いです。

Solrを使用して多次元空間を構築したいと思います.5次元としましょう。このスペースには、ポイントがあるはずです。

ここで、特定のポイントに最も近いポイントを見つけたいと思います。

多次元空間検索に関する信頼できる情報を見つけようとしました。しかし、私は助けになるものを見つけることができませんでした。

Solr Wiki には、空間検索に関する記事があります。しかし、そこでは 2 次元しか使用していません。

私の質問は次のとおりです。Solr は多次元空間検索の機能を提供しますか?